Not Bad For a Girl: the beat goes on! Katie Marie gets experimental with her funky beats

Singer songerwriter Katie Marie

After regaling you last week with tales of strange mystic folk from Plymouth, this week I thought I’d share with you the fun I’ve been having in my lovely little studio.

Last week I met up with Chris Woods who is a guitarist friend of mine and we were having lots of fun jamming various ideas ‘n’ stuff. I armed myself with a cajon and also thought I’d try mixing a cajon sound with a stomp box to see how it would work… and I have to say the results were superb! Thus far I’ve only used my Logarhythm when playing my acoustic guitar, but used sparsely with the cajon it really added so much to the groove.

The night after our jam I had dreams about all sorts of weird and wonderful things (all clean I’m afraid). Most of which I can’t really remember, but what I do remember was dreaming about creating some really funky beats using two Logarhythms and I’d plugged in various guitar FX pedals to each one to create a totally different kind of tone. So when I woke up I promised myself I’d give it a try, just for fun, and here’s what happened ;)

Katie Marie

I dragged out all the various guitar pedals I’d collected over the years and set about seeing what worked and what didn’t. Eventually I ended up with my DOD Envolope Filter which gave the best results by a mile. It made my Logarhythm sound really synthy and depending on how hard I stomped it depended on how deep a tone I got, yay!

So I got Karon (my cajon) all micked up and set up one Logarhythm plugged into an Envolope filter and the other clean.

I micked up Karon with 3 mics, my trusty AKG D-112 just outside the soundhole along with an SM57 just behind that. I also put a Rode NT1a up front which you’ll hear also picks up my tapping the right Logarhythm!

So here’s a MP3 of a jam I had earlier. This was all done live using Karon and my two Logarhythms, see what ya think :)

Other than messing around with Logs n FX, I’m also in the process of recording two cover songs for a radio station.  One is my infamous acoustic version of Jump by Kriss Kross and the other is Pokerface by Lady Gaga, will let you know how I get on next week.

On the gig side of things, I’m looking forward to playing at the Bay Horse in Totnes this evening with local singer/songwriter Nicky Swann. It’s all part of the Totnes Festival so it’ll hopefully be a busy one. Tomorrow night I’ll be armed with Martha my Musicman bass as I lay down oodles of tasty riffs for jazz/funk trio Miquid Licks. We’ll be at the Barbican Jazz Cafe in Plymouth and then finally I’ll be playing at the Awliscombe Inn with Nicky. Looking forward to it.
